摘要
Twenty-nine extracts of 18 medicinal plants used in New Caledonia by traditional healers to treat inflammation, fever and in cicatrizing remedies were evaluated in vitro against several parasites (Leishmania donovani, Trypanosoma brucei brucei, Trichomonas vaginalis and Caenorhabditis elegans). Among the selected plants, Scaevola balansae and Premna serratifolia L. were the most active against Leishmania donovani with IC50 values between 5 and 10 mu g/ml. The almond and aril extracts from Myristica fatua had an IC50 value of 0.5-5 mu g/ml against Trypanosoma brucei brucei. Only Scaevola balansae extract presented a weak activity against Trichomonas vaginalis. The almond extract from Myristica fatua presented significant activity against Caenorhabditis elegans (IC50 value of 6.6 +/- 1.2 mu g/ml). (C) 2007 Elsevier Ireland Ltd. All rights reserved.
